यदि \(OP=\sqrt{8}\) से आगे (5) नए चरण बनाए जाएं, तो अंतिम कर्ण क्या होगा?

If (5) new steps are constructed after \(OP=\sqrt{8}\), what will be the final hypotenuse?

Correct Answer

C. \(\sqrt{13}\)

Step 1

Concept

At each new step, the inner number increases by (1), so (8+5=13). The final hypotenuse is \(\sqrt{13}\).
